WorkbookBase.ContentTypeProperties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ient une collection des propriétés qui décrivent des métadonnées stockées dans le classeur.
public:
property Microsoft::Office::Core::MetaProperties ^ ContentTypeProperties { Microsoft::Office::Core::MetaProperties ^ get(); };
public Microsoft.Office.Core.MetaProperties ContentTypeProperties { get; }
member this.ContentTypeProperties : Microsoft.Office.Core.MetaProperties
Public ReadOnly Property ContentTypeProperties As MetaProperties
Valeur de propriété
Collection Microsoft.Office.Core.MetaProperties qui contient des propriétés qui décrivent les métadonnées stockées dans le classeur.
Exemples
L’exemple de code suivant récupère les métadonnées associées au classeur actuel. L’exemple montre le nombre total de propriétés de métadonnées trouvées, suivi du nom et de la valeur de chaque propriété. Pour exécuter cet exemple, vous devez publier le classeur dans une bibliothèque de documents Microsoft Office SharePoint Server et fournir une propriété de métadonnées personnalisée pour ce classeur. Par exemple, vous pouvez ajouter une colonne dans la bibliothèque de documents où le classeur est publié. Pour plus d’informations sur les propriétés de type de contenu, reportez-vous à la documentation microsoft Office SharePoint Server.
Cet exemple concerne une personnalisation au niveau du document.
private void GetContentTypeProperties()
{
Office.MetaProperties props = this.ContentTypeProperties;
MessageBox.Show("Number of metadata properties found: "
+ props.Count.ToString());
foreach (Office.MetaProperty prop in props)
{
MessageBox.Show("Metadata property name: " + prop.Name
+ "\r\nMetadata property value: "
+ prop.Value.ToString());
}
}
Private Sub GetContentTypeProperties()
Dim props As Office.MetaProperties = Me.ContentTypeProperties
MessageBox.Show("Number of metadata properties found: " _
+ props.Count.ToString())
For Each prop As Office.MetaProperty In props
MessageBox.Show("Metadata property name: " + prop.Name _
+ vbCrLf + "Metadata property value: " _
+ prop.Value.ToString())
Next
End Sub